Are stuff packs still a thing? Well somehow we should get an update to books/writing with some new features and maybe new objects. Added to a university expansion could be cool.
•Choose the appearance/book covers of any books your sims write: choose from any designs already in game + color and pattern options.
•Order books your sims have written (and books they’ve written should be saved with your sims when you start a new game or upload them to the gallery)
•New ways to write- Typewriters and pen/paper objects for sims to practice writing, write books, and write letters.
•Librarian active career- Work at a library venue, complete daily tasks, unlock social interactions and objects.
•New Rare Books Collection- Collect unique looking books that can teach skills quickly.
•6 sided game table- (for libraries or homes) Up to six sims can play cards, a board game, a fantasy role playing game (like dungeons and dragons), solve puzzles, contact the dead with a ouji board, do homework/study together, or use it as a regular six sided table.
•A new globe object for sims to spin with fun fact notifications like the stump object from TS2 Bon Voyage.
•Read in bed interaction.

Also, it'd be nice if reading books gained some skill for kids? It's weird to me that it doesn't. I think kids should gain either creative or mental skill depending on the book, and also get frustrated more easily if they're reading "above their reading level." And this should carry over to being read to as well; like, the mental kid's aspiration has "read with an adult" as a requirement, but that does NOTHING to build the mental skill, or do anything at all, and mostly seems like a waste of time, lol. Toddlers gain imagination, but kids get nothing out of books or from being read to. It's a bummer.
Lastly, I think it'd be cool if Sims reacted to non-skill books the way they did with movies oor something. Like, different sims would like different types of books, find some boring, that kind of thing. I dunno, just something that makes the non skill and emotion books no completely interchangeable, lol.
